DMI/Desktop Management Interface DMI is an Operating System/Network Operating System-independent management framework that allows system vendors to support multiple market/customer segments with a single management strategy. DMI lowers the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) by providing a common framework for managing desktop systems, mobile systems and servers.
D-Link DFE-550TX Ethernet Adapter Traffic Management Statistics The DFE-550TX incorporates sixteen packet counters that can be used by network management applications. This is far greater than the three mandatory counters implemented by most other network interface cards. The large number of counters on the DFE-550TX allows network management applications to provide accurate and detailed statistics on a wide range of network attributes. D-Link DFE-550TX Ethernet Adapter Verification/Diagnostic Program This test program verifies configuration of the DFE-550TX as set by the installation procedure, and assists with isolation of any faults in operation. Verification and testing procedures are optional, and will only be useful in the unusual event that there is a fault, such as an interrupt number conflict among your computer expansion cards. If your installation provides normal operation, you might choose to skip these procedures.
